Output 5eafa18c3b3311be19412345ac67d68d836bb9869a190c5a35e2fc6fd423cebd:1

value
18479074
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b639560d5d0e04b633daffd504920482e4aa3b52 OP_EQUAL
address
MQWfu8Pkga5UuzWXxZrLgQuP1Nm4wiM5N4
transaction
5eafa18c3b3311be19412345ac67d68d836bb9869a190c5a35e2fc6fd423cebd
spent
true